Transaction de662a49ed541042e3bf5259dd56a1065bb206c9370fb1446864877590a51051
1 Input
1 Output
-
de662a49ed541042e3bf5259dd56a1065bb206c9370fb1446864877590a51051:0
- value
- 62249445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58b9b45c3492de47231c4f002827b80f1980a9a3 OP_EQUAL
- address
- MFzJAHgFwfhr3LbS5fsTXkssyREPmk1Ajf